Stratford (London) station is equipped with a variety of amenities designed to comfort and convenience. The station's ticket office is open from 6:15 AM to 9:30 PM during the week,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ets at your convenience, no matter when your travels commence. Accessible ticket machines and smartcard validators make purchasing tickets straightforward, even on the busiest days.
For those seeking information or assistance, staff is readily available at help points, the ticket office, and dedicated information points. Featuring step-free access and induction loops, the station ensures that everyone can travel with ease. Whether you require accessible toilets, baby changing facilities, or simply a place to sit while waiting for your train, the station accommodates your needs. Have a look at the TfL Lost Property page should you misplace something during your visit.
With convenient transport links at its doorstep, Stratford Station is a gateway to a variety of travel options. Rail replacement services ensure that travel plans are seamless, even during disruptions. On Great Eastern Road, the taxi rank makes for an easy exit to your next adventure, be it business or leisure. A plethora of bus services operates just outside the station, ready to whisk you away into London’s vast expanse. If the underground tickles your fancy, the Central and Jubilee Lines, along with Docklands Light Railway, are at your service.
Planning a getaway can even include airports, with connections via the Elizabeth Line to Heathrow, DLR to London City Airport, or Greater Anglia to Stansted Airport. All these options combine to make Stratford (London) an ideal starting point for both domestic and international travel.

Clapton station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Although the ticket office operates only on weekdays from 07:30 to 10:00, there are ticket machines available for your convenience. These machines are accessible to all passengers, including those with disabilities. While there is a lack of smartcard provision, the station makes ticket collection from online purchases simple and easy.
For those needing assistance, there are helpful station staff available at designated information points. Clapton station is fitted with CCTV, ensuring safety, and there are various customer help points for immediate support. While it lacks some amenities like toilets and shops, it is a well-monitored space with ample seating areas for those needing a quick rest.
Though Clapton station is classified in accessibility category C, meaning it lacks step-free access, it does provide some supportive features. There are acc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and wheelchairs available for those in need. However, passengers requiring a ramp for train access or accessible taxis should plan their journey accordingly, as these services are not available at this station.
Clapton station is well-connected with other transport methods. For bus travel, local London buses frequently operate from stops just outside the station. Additionally, for northbound services to Chingford, passengers can head to Bus stop A in Upper Clapton Road. For southbound journeys towards Liverpool Street, Bus stop P is ready to serve.
